Idera Acquires WhereScape
September 19, 2019

Idera announced an agreement to acquire the software assets and related entities of WhereScape Software LTD., a provider of data infrastructure automation software.

WhereScape will join Idera’s database tools business unit that includes IDERA, AquaFold, and Webyog, significantly expanding the breadth and depth of the company’s cross-platform database solutions.

“WhereScape solves a significant challenge for data infrastructure projects by automating tasks like building data pipelines while consolidating multiple tools and disparate skills into a cohesive solution. WhereScape’s tools reduce timelines, generate significant ROI, and deliver immediate business value,” said Matt O’Connell, Idera’s GM for WhereScape.

WhereScape’s end-to-end tooling offers the speed, quality, and consistency needed for business users to pivot from outdated manual methods to modern automated processes. More than 700 customers, and a worldwide partner ecosystem, rely on the company’s award-winning products — WhereScape 3D, WhereScape RED, and WhereScape Data Vault Express — to design, develop, deploy, and operate data infrastructure projects, both on-premises and in the cloud.

“WhereScape is a strategic addition to our growing portfolio of cross-platform database solutions for big data automation and cloud migration. As the market shifts to support DevOps use cases for data professionals, WhereScape will be even more important to companies managing complex data environments across platforms and channels. By focusing our product investment on ease of use, scalability, and quality, we expect WhereScape to remain the leading data migration solution and drive more value for our 10,000+ customers,” said Randy Jacops, CEO of Idera, Inc.
